Former N-Dubz singer Tulisa Contostavl­os last week revealed she’d been silently suffering from a condition called Bell’s palsy, which causes temporary paralysis and drooping on one side of the face.

Hitting back at trolls who had often heartlessl­y targeted her over her appearance – with one even likening her to a stroke victim – Tulisa,

31, told Loose Women viewers how she developed symptoms after sustaining nerve damage from a horse riding accident.

She confessed, “There’s been times people have criticised the way I look and my face, not knowing I’m going through a Bell’s palsy attack.

“Someone online said I looked like I was having a stroke.

“I have emergency steroids on me and I know how to handle it. If you have steroids within a 72-hour period, it can last days instead of seven months, which happened to me the first time. I was hiding in the house.”

Revealing the devastatin­g effects of online abuse, she continued, “I just think it’s such a big issue with this current generation. It’s not just celebritie­s. It’s young people going through it.

“I had people referencin­g my uncle’s death, my mother’s mental illness, loads of threats. The lowest of the lows.”

Since enjoying chart success as one third of the Camden-born hip-hop group from 2007 to 2011, and being dubbed “the nation’s new sweetheart” when she replaced Cheryl as a judge on The X Factor in 2011, Tulisa has endured a roller coaster ride.

In 2013, she became the victim of a tabloid sting and was arrested on suspicion of supplying class A drugs. The trial sensationa­lly collapsed when the judge ruled the reporter who’d conducted the investigat­ion tampered with evidence – but it was Tulisa’s face that made the most headlines as she appeared outside the court room with worryingly swollen lips and taut skin.

Fans again cruelly mocked her dramatical­ly altered appearance, labelling her “unrecognis­able” when she returned to the spotlight on Good Morning Britain last year to promote her new solo album.

ADDICTED

Despite initially denying she’d had surgery, she later confessed to TV host Lorraine that she became addicted to fillers and likened herself to Finding Nemo after suffering an allergic reaction – puffing up her lips to the camera as she impersonat­ed the Disney clownfish character.

After Lorraine told her, “You don’t even need it – you’re beautiful!”, she replied, “I’m happy now. I still have little bits of filler in my lips and I get lots of treatments and skincare. It’s all about maintainin­g.”
